Induction hobs
Induction hobs have flat, sleek surfaces that are simpler than gas hobs to wash. They are energy efficient and provide precise temperature control. This makes them ideal for delicate sauces or searing meats. They also cool quickly, meaning you won't burn your fingers if you touch the surface. You'll need a set of cookware that is compatible to make use of these. They aren't suitable for those with pacemakers, as the electromagnetic field created by induction could interfere with.
Induction hobs usually have indicators that show the power levels and settings. This gives your kitchen an edgy look. Certain models include bridge zones, which allow you to mix cooking areas in order to accommodate larger pans. This makes them an ideal option for griddles or roasting pans. You can also find models with a boost function that temporarily increases the power output of a zone, allowing you to bring water up to boiling point or sear meat more quickly.
A residual heat indicator is another useful feature. It indicates that the stove is hot even after it has been shut off. This can prevent accidental burns, especially in the case of children in your household. Some stoves have child locks to keep your little ones safe while you're cooking.

Gas hobs
Gas hobs are a staple of UK kitchens due to their combination of instant heating and precise temperature control. They also sport a sleek and professional look that can be integrated into a variety of kitchen designs. In addition, most modern gas hobs feature automatic ignition. This means that turning on the stove triggers an electric spark to ignite the gas inside the burner. This is much safer than older models of gas hobs that required lighters or matchboxes. Gas hobs feature a visible flame indicator that allows you to determine if the flame is on. This can prevent gas leaks and accidental burns.
There are a variety of different choices for gas hobs, ranging from simple single-burner designs to large powerful wok burners. Some models even include dual flame burners that allow you to alter the size of the flame as well as precisely regulate the heat. Other features include vortex flames that prevent the loss of heat from the sides, and a sleek durable surface that is easy to clean.

Hobs made of solid-plate
Offering a simple but reliable cooking solution Solid plate hobs have served as the mainstay of many homes for many years. Electricity is used to cook flat metal plates, which makes this an affordable option that is simple to use and maintain. However, their basic design may not be as efficient than other hobs and result in higher electric bills. Additionally, they take longer to warm up and cool down than other hobs. This can be a hassle if you're used to faster cook times.
Solid plate hobs are a good choice for those who are on a tight budget. They offer even heating and are compatible with all kinds of pots. They also have simple dial controls that make it easy to make temperature adjustment. They also have an indicator light that shows when the plate is hot or in use to ensure safety.
However, the solid plate design is susceptible to short circuits in electrical current and could require more maintenance than other hobs. They also are less flexible than other types of hobs such as induction and ceramic.

Ceramic hobs
Modern and stylish Ceramic hobs are stylish and sleek, making them an extremely popular choice for modern kitchens. They are also less expensive than other models due to their flat surface. They are also extremely energy efficient since the heating elements only heat the hob surface and not the pans on the top.
As with induction hobs and ceramic hobs come with a range of features to help you cook more efficiently and more practical. Certain models, for instance, have a FlexiDuo feature that allows you to combine two cooking zones in one space to be able to handle larger pots. These models are also equipped with residual temperature indicators as well as child locks to ensure your children's safety.
The primary difference between an induction and ceramic hob is that ceramic hobs do not make use of magnetic fields to warm the pans. Instead, they use heating elements that are electric beneath each cooking zone. This means they may take a little longer to warm up and cool down than induction hobs.
